Sensorimotor
Relating to or involving both sensory and motor functions, or the stage in Piaget's theory of cognitive development (from birth to about 2 years) where infants learn through sensory and motor interaction with the world.
Primary Circular Reactions
Early infantile behaviors that repeat because the infant finds them pleasurable, occurring in the sensorimotor stage of development.
Secondary Circular Reactions
Repetitive behaviors centered around the infant's own body, typically developed between 4-8 months of age, which indicate a growth in sensory and motor skills.
Tertiary Circular Reactions
The exploratory behaviors observed in infants from about 12 to 18 months of age, characterized by the purposeful adaptation of established schemas to new situations.
